Transaction 26d815d270a4a11ea127e4c70eda51611dbf62a2d21ad16bdc542934e24adf3c

1 Input
2 Outputs
  • 26d815d270a4a11ea127e4c70eda51611dbf62a2d21ad16bdc542934e24adf3c:0
  • value  20093736
    address  17cmGG2PtSkgez9czyXQAYiFmc3gLeN6zL
  • 26d815d270a4a11ea127e4c70eda51611dbf62a2d21ad16bdc542934e24adf3c:1
  • value  720459912
    address  1BfNzvCx75KNehcYZUojwG1gBBqjp6gFZ